The Gothamist House during CMJ: Saturday Lineup

bissell.jpg

We mentioned a little while back that we will be holding a series of day parties while CMJ is going on. With only a few weeks to go, we'd like to officially announce the lineup for the Saturday show, which will run from 2 till 8pm on November 4th at the White Rabbit on East Houston street. Each of the bands will perform a special acoustic or otherwise stripped down set. As we mentioned before, the shows will all be free and open to the public, so anyone (21+, unfortunately) is welcome to stop by, grab a drink and check out the bands! There is much more to be announced very soon, including the lineups for the rest of the days, so stay tuned!

2:15 - The Prayers and Tears of Arthur Digby Sellers (Listen at Myspace)

3:00 - Judah Johnson (myspace)

3:45 - Wooden Wand (myspace)

4:30 - The End of the World (myspace)

5:15 - Loney, Dear (myspace)

6:00 - Panda & Angel (myspace)

6:45 - Cities (myspace)

7:30 - Charles Bissell (of the Wrens) (myspace)
